How to read this

Every point is one experimental protein structure. The horizontal axis is AlphaFold's own confidence in its prediction (mean pLDDT, 0–100). The vertical axis is how well that blind prediction actually matches the experiment (TM-score, 0–1; above 0.5 means the same fold, above 0.9 near-identical). Marker size grows with the FRAUD score (confidence-weighted error).

Cutoff: the shaded red box is the "confidently wrong" zone — AlphaFold was confident (mean pLDDT above 70) yet the fold is wrong (TM-score below 0.5). A predictor that had truly solved folding would leave that box empty.

Read moreShow less — how each metric is calculated

TM-score: how similar the two 3D shapes are overall, 0–1 (a random pair scores ~0.17, an identical fold ~1). Length-normalised so large and small proteins compare fairly. TM = (1/L) Σᵢ 1/(1 + (dᵢ/d₀)²) — dᵢ is the gap between the i-th aligned Cα atoms after best-fit superposition, and d₀ = 1.24(L−15)^⅓ − 1.8 sets the distance scale for length L. Ref: Zhang & Skolnick, Proteins 2004 doi:10.1002/prot.20264; computed with TM-align, doi:10.1093/nar/gki524.

pLDDT: AlphaFold's own confidence in each residue, 0–100 (higher = surer). It is the model predicting its own accuracy before ever seeing the experiment. We plot the per-structure mean. pLDDT = (1/N) Σᵢ pLDDTᵢ, where pLDDTᵢ is the network's confidence output for residue i.

FRAUD score: the headline number — how wrong the prediction was, weighted by how confident AlphaFold was, so a big error it was sure about counts most. FRAUD = (1/N) Σᵢ (pLDDTᵢ/100) · min(Δᵢ,15)/15, where Δᵢ is residue i's Cα distance from the experiment (Å) after superposition, capped at 15 Å. Runs 0 (perfect) to 1.

Novelty: how little AlphaFold had to go on — 100 minus the highest sequence identity between this protein and any structure released before the 2018-04-30 training cutoff. High = genuinely unseen (100% = nothing similar was ever in the training set). novelty = 100 − maxₚ identity(s, p) over pre-cutoff PDB chains p, with identity = 100 × (matching aligned residues)/(alignment length), from an MMseqs2 search.

Homology: the point colour. High novelty (above 70%) flags the sequence as novel (amber) — AlphaFold had no close template; otherwise a pre-cutoff homolog existed (blue) it could have learned the fold from. novel ⇔ novelty > 70%.

What the metrics mean

TM-score (0–1): overall fold match — above 0.5 is the same fold, above 0.9 near-identical. Cα-RMSD (Å): average backbone distance after best-fit superposition — lower is better (under 2 Å is excellent). lDDT (0–1): local accuracy measured without superposition — above 0.8 is good. Read moreShow less — how each metric is calculated

TM-score: overall shape match, 0–1 (above 0.5 = same fold, above 0.9 near-identical), length-normalised. TM = (1/L) Σᵢ 1/(1 + (dᵢ/d₀)²) with dᵢ the aligned-Cα gap after superposition and d₀ = 1.24(L−15)^⅓ − 1.8. Ref: Zhang & Skolnick, Proteins 2004 doi:10.1002/prot.20264.

Cα-RMSD: the average straight-line distance between matching backbone Cα atoms once the two structures are best-fit superposed (Å; lower is better, under ~2 Å excellent). RMSD = √( (1/N) Σᵢ |Pᵢ − (R·Qᵢ + t)|² ), with Pᵢ/Qᵢ the experimental/model Cα coordinates and R,t the rotation and translation from Kabsch superposition.

lDDT: local accuracy with no superposition — the fraction of short-range inter-residue distances the model reproduces, so it is not fooled by a single wrongly-placed domain. lDDT = (1/N) Σᵢ ¼ Σ_t 1[ |d_exp − d_model| < t ] over thresholds t ∈ {0.5, 1, 2, 4} Å and all residue pairs within 15 Å.

Trend over time

The blue line is the mean TM-score of the structures by their deposit month; the red bars count how many were confidently wrong. Binning by deposit date (rather than by when we processed them) gives an even timeline, tracking whether AlphaFold's accuracy on newly-deposited structures is holding steady, improving, or slipping as the PDB keeps growing. Months with fewer than 5 structures are omitted so each point is a meaningful average. A dashed trend line is drawn only if the change over time is statistically significant.

Read moreShow less — how each metric is calculated

Mean TM-score: the month's average shape-match score. TM̄ = (1/M) Σ TM over the M structures deposited that month.

Trend line: a monotonic-trend test over the monthly means — Mann-Kendall (Kendall's τ) for significance, with a robust Theil-Sen slope for the line. Rank-based, so it tolerates the skewed TM distribution and noisy low-count months. Shown only when p < 0.05; otherwise a note reports that no significant trend was found.

Confidently wrong: the count that were both confident and wrong. count( mean pLDDT > 70 AND TM < 0.5 ).
